Expect moving costs from Fargo to Bremerton to vary based on the size of your household. Small moves generally range from $1,466 to $1,527, medium moves from $1,686 to $1,756, and large moves from $1,906 to $1,985. Prices fluctuate due to factors such as distance, volume of belongings, and additional services like packing or storage. Planning ahead and comparing quotes can help you find the best value for your move.

Moving costs from Fargo to Bremerton vary by home size and services. Small moves range from $1,466 to $1,527, medium moves from $1,686 to $1,756, and large moves from $1,906 to $1,985. Additional services like packing or storage can affect the final price.
Standard delivery for moves between Fargo and Bremerton typically takes about 3 days. Expedited delivery options are available and can reduce transit time to 2 days, depending on the moving company and scheduling.
The most affordable option is usually a self-service move where you pack and load your belongings, and the company handles transportation. However, full-service moves offer convenience but at a higher cost.
Booking your move several weeks in advance can secure better rates and availability. Avoid peak moving seasons like summer months to reduce costs and ensure smoother scheduling.
Yes, moving companies operating between states like North Dakota and Washington must be licensed interstate movers. This ensures compliance with federal regulations and protects your shipment.
